Check the useMenu Hook: The sidebar (ThemedSiderV2) uses the useMenu hook to generate menu items based on the resources defined in the Refine component. Ensure that your resources are correctly defined and that the useMenu hook is functioning as expected. 3. UI Tests for Sidebar: Ensure that your UI tests are correctly set up to render the sidebar. The error message "Unable to find role='a'" suggests that the sidebar links are not being rendered. Verify that the ThemedSiderV2 component is correctly generating the links. 4. Example of UI Test: Here is an example of how you might set up your UI test to render the sidebar and check for links:
import { render, screen, act } from '@testing-library/react';
import { createRemixStub } from 'remix-testing-library';
import App from './App'; // Ensure this path is correct
const RemixStub = createRemixStub([
{
path: "/",
Component: App
},
]);

await act(async () => {
render(
<RemixStub initialEntries={['/']} />
);
});

const links = await screen.findAllByRole('link'); // Ensure the role matches the rendered elements
expect(links).not.toBeNull();

Make sure that the role you are querying ('link' in this case) matches the role of the elements rendered by your sidebar.
